您的位置:首页 > 数据库

数据库系统概述

2018-03-28 20:49 260 查看

1、数据库的四个基本概念

数据库技术是信息系统的核心和基础,它的出现极大地促进了计算机应用向各行各业的渗透。

1.1、数据

数据(Data)是数据库中存储的基本对象
数据的定义:描述事物的符号记录(描述数据的符号可以是数字,文字,图形,图像,声音等等
数据的种类:文字、图形、图象、声音
数据的特点:数据与其语义是不可分的(比如100,既可以表示价钱,也可以表示距离,同样可以表示速度)

1.2、数据库

数据库的定义:数据库(Database,简称DB)是长期储存在计算机内、有组织的、可共享的大量数据的集合。
数据库的基本特征

数据按一定的数据模型组织、描述和储存
可为各种用户共享
冗余度较小(节省存储空间、减少硬件开销,数据库中数据本身的正确性)冗余度:同一个数据在同一个数据库中存储的次数。
数据独立性较高
易扩展(数据和数据之间的关联性,数据和数据之间是有关联的,这种关联不应该影响其他的数据)

1.3、数据库管理系统

什么是DBMS?

位于用户与操作系统之间的一层数据管理软件。(介于用户和操作系统之间的软件)
基础软件,是一个大型复杂的软件系统
DBMS的主要功能:
1、数据定义功能

提供数据定义语言(DDL)
定义数据库中的数据对象
2、数据组织、存储和管理

分类组织、存储和管理各种数据
确定组织数据的文件结构和存取方式
存取方式:顺序、链接、索引、散列、查找
实现数据之间的联系
提供多种存取方法提高存取效率
3、数据操纵功能

提供数据操纵语言(DML)
实现对数据库的基本操作  (查询、插入、删除和修改)
4、数据库的事务管理和运行管理

数据库在建立、运行和维护时由DBMS统一管理和控制保证数据的安全性、完整性、多用户对数据的并发使用发生故障后的系统恢复
尽可能保证数据不因故障而丢失,即使丢失也能通过相应的技术来恢复
5、数据库的建立和维护功能

数据库初始数据装载转换
数据库转储
介质故障恢复
数据库的重组织
性能监视分析等
6、其它功能

DBMS与网络中其它软件系统的通信
两个DBMS系统的数据转换
异构数据库之间的互访和互操作

1.4、数据库系统

数据库系统(Database System,DBS):在计算机系统中引入数据库后的系统是由数据库数据库管理系统应用程序数据库管理员组成的存储、管理、处理和维护数据的系统
数据库系统的构成: 硬件平台及数据库 软件 人员

2、数据管理技术的产生和发展

人工管理阶段


文件系统阶段

数据库系统阶段

 

3、数据库系统的特点

数据结构化
数据的共享性高,冗余度低,易扩充
数据独立性高
数据由DBMS统一管理和控制
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息